[QUOTE="scythe000, post: 282394, member: 78738"] Well, I tried posting this in another forum, but maybe this one is more appropriate. MediaPortal Version: Latest SVN MediaPortal Skin: xFace Windows Version: Vista Ultimate 32 CPU Type: Core2Duo HDD: 500GB Sata Memory: 3GB DDR Motherboard: Video Card: nVidia 7x series Video Card Driver: Latest Okay, getting to be a long list of quirks, so I figure I'll list them here. As I'm sure to solve some, this will also serve as a convenient n00b solution thread, lol. 1. xFace is showing empty gray boxes in the My TV Series plugin at 1920x1200 res. 2. It's also not showing the DVD Cover Art for each Season. This may be by design, but would be really easy to fix. 3. Music Album Art is not stretching to extents in the Big Icon/Tile/Thumbnail view 4. Artist pics in My Music is not preserving aspect ratio (looks stretched/squashed). 5. My TV Series is picking up on movies on the same drive as my TV Series. This seems to be by design, but ought to have a "exclude sub-folder" option. 6. I can't seem to switch the ugly default WMP visualization to something better like Milkdrop, Geiss or TwistedPixel. 7. My Music Videos shows a blank screen no matter what menu option I select from the left. 8. My Trailers pulls the movie name, and then on the trailer page shows an http error. It looks like maybe Yahoo changed their URL format? 9. xFace is not wrapping actor information properly in the My TV Series page. It obscures the episode thumbnail and spills over to the episode summary, and covers the airing date. 10. My Music detects album and artist names as different if there is a difference in captialization. Can we change this? 11. In My Music, it labels all songs as 'Unknown' album, if it's not tagged. This ought to be changed to search by artist+song name, so we can pick what album it's from in the list. 12. in Xface, when a video is playing and one presses backspace or the back arrow on the remote, audio is playing, but no video thumbnail is shown., unless one backs out all the way to the home screen. This could easily be placed in the bottom left, covering the episode thumbnail. 13. Strange behaivior in My Music, where sometimes the visualization thumb gets focus, and it is impossible to switch focus except by backing up. 14. My Pictures doesn't auto-resize pictures. It should do this by height or width, whichever is greater, and respect aspect ratio. That's all for now, TIA! [/QUOTE]
